Apply for a Septic System Pumper’s Licence

2024-02-05

Who requires a pumper’s license? Any person/business that undertakes the cleaning of a sewage disposal system or the disposal of septage or biosolids. What is septage? Septage is material removed from a septic tank. Septic tanks should be cleaned as needed (every 3 to 5 years) using a Licensed Pumper. Licensed Pumpers are required to haul this material to an approved facility for processing and treatment. Charlottetown or Summerside both have approved disposal facilities. Renew your Driver’s License Online

2026-01-14

Prince Edward Island has a 5-year motor vehicle driver's license. All PEI residents are required to renew their driver’s license on or before the expiry date shown on their current license. Rather than wait until the last minute, you can renew your license up to 5 months before your card expires. This can be done by using the online form below, or in-person by visiting an Access PEI location near you. Energy Efficiency Loan Program – Online Application

2021-01-19

Island residents adding energy efficiency upgrades to their home may be eligible to borrow up to $10,000 from the provincial government to help finance the cost. The Energy Efficiency Loan Program is available to a registered owner of a year-round residential property and where the project has been pre-approved by efficiencyPEI. The loan may assist with purchasing efficient equipment such as a new furnace or heat pump or it may help with the cost of upgrades to the building envelope, i.e. new windows or air sealing. Correctional Officer Training Program

2025-11-07

In partnership with the Atlantic Police Academy (APA), the six-month Correctional Officer Training Program will develop 12 students’ skills and knowledge on intervention and de-escalation strategies, crisis management, Canadian law, ethics and professionalism, workplace health and safety, as well as topics specific to correctional services. The program will begin January 5, 2026, and will include 17 weeks of course work and a seven-week on-the-job training component at Island correctional centres. Family Housing

2024-05-20

Island families and individuals unable to obtain or maintain adequate housing due to a low household income, poor housing conditions, or other special circumstances may be eligible for family housing through the Family Housing Program. Eligible applicants may be approved for: Government-owned housing: Bachelor to four-bedroom units are equipped with essential appliances and utility services. Tenants must supply their own furniture and maintain tenant’s insurance coverage.
